The UV-5RM Pro is the clear winner for most users, offering superior value and performance at roughly half the price of the GD-168.
The most important differentiator is power output. The UV-5RM Pro delivers 10W of transmit power compared to the GD-168's 5W, giving you twice the range and stronger signal penetration. This alone justifies its higher overall score and makes a tangible difference in real-world operations.
The UV-5RM Pro is ideal for budget-conscious operators who prioritize range and want built-in GPS and APRS capabilities for location tracking and emergency communication. The GD-168 suits users specifically committed to DMR digital mode who can afford the premium price and accept lower power output as a tradeoff.
The UV-5RM Pro's combination of affordable pricing, higher power, and practical feature set makes it the stronger choice for general amateur radio use. Unless you have a specific need for DMR networks in your area, the UV-5RM Pro delivers better bang for your buck. Reasons to choose Baofeng UV-5RM Pro
- 57% cheaper ($59.99 vs $139.99)
- 100% more TX power (10W vs 5W)
- 39% more battery (2500 mAh vs 1800 mAh)
- Has built-in GPS
Reasons to choose Radioddity GD-168
- 6x more memory channels (4,000 vs 640)
- Has DMR digital mode
